The scriptures tell us of the incalculable value of even a moment's association with a true saint, and Sri Srimad Bhaktivedanta Narayana Gosvami Maharaja is exalted even among saints. With great sincerity, his disciples and followers thus availed themselves of any opportunity to accompany him on his morning walks and attend his morning darsanas. In those informal settings, they freely asked a variety of questions, his illuminating responses revealing a mere glimpse of the devotion radiating brilliantly within his heart. Sometimes personal, sometimes disciplinary, sometimes humorous and always loving, he would impart the deepest understandings of the scriptures for the benefit of all. It was on his repeated order that these walks and darsanas be transcribed and published. In this way, he has invited you, also, to walk with him and hear the jewel-like teachings he wants to share with you.
"TV Interview:-
Charles: What does it mean to be following in your guru's footsteps?
Srila Narayana Gosvami Maharaja: Before I came to serve the mission of my gurudeva full-time, I was a police-officer. I had the good fortune to meet the disciples of Srila Bhaktisiddhanta Sarasvati Thakura, who preached the message of sanatana-dharma throughout India and the entire world. I met one of his main disciples, Sri Narottamananda Brahmacari, where I was residing in Tiwaripur. Hearing his lecture, I became so attracted that I left my house, wife, and children, and moved into the temple. After this, I received so many teachings from my spiritual master. Then I took initiation from him, and from him I could understand the guru-parampara and the necessity of the disciplic succession. From him I heard that we are not this material body. Under the misconception that, "I am this body," the souls of this world have completely forgotten their relationship with Krsna. Because of this forgetfulness, they are constantly transmigrating throughout thousands of cycles of creation and dissolution, and they are not able to find any happiness. From this guru-parampara and from hearing the teachings of my spiritual master, I understood that the goal of life is devotion to the Supreme Lord Krsna and to go back to God, back to home.
This guru-parampara began with the Supreme Lord Krsna Himself. He instructed His teachings to the first created being, Brahma. Brahma instructed his disciple, Narada, Narada instructed his disciple, Vyasa, and in this way the teachings came down to Sri Caitanya Mahaprabhu, the Six Gosvamis, Srila Narottama dasa Thakura, Sri Srinivasa Acarya, Sri Syamananda, Srila Bhaktivinoda Thakura, Srila Bhaktisiddhanta Sarasvati Thakura, then to my gurudeva, and I am receiving these teachings from him. I am now traveling throughout large and small countries, and giving people the chance to hear this same message of sanatana-dharma. What is sanatana-dharma? It is the teaching that the individual soul is eternal, the Supreme Lord is eternal, and our relationship with the Supreme Lord is our eternal natural function (dharma). When the individual soul becomes situated in his dharma, he becomes happy.
Hearing these instructions, I left everything, moved into the maṭha, and gradually began engaging in giving this message to others. By following the programs in the maṭha, I could appreciate the great benefit I was receiving and knew that by instructing others there would be so much benefit for them. With this intention I am traveling the entire world, giving this message that I heard from my gurudeva.
Charles: Each country you go to has a different way of living, a different cultural heritage, and different problems. How do you think your message will be geared towards South Africans?
Srila Narayana Gosvami Maharaja: No matter which country I go to, I find that many people are wealthy, and they have big positions like chief ministers or advisors in the government. Despite having such good positions, however, they are desperately unhappy and many even commit suicide. Despite having vast wealth, large families, good positions in society, and great opulence, still they are not happy. I tell people, "You cannot be happy by eating nicely and having nice clothing and possessions. Death comes to all, and with death comes so much suffering." When people hear this from me, they develop faith and give up all bad habits like drinking, smoking, meat-eating, and taking garlic and onions. I instruct them to chant the name of Krsna, which is Krsna Himself. There is no difference between God and His names – Hare, Krsna, and Rama. His names are very powerful. In fact, Krsna has invested all of His power, mercy, and qualities in these three names, or sixteen words [of the maha-mantra]. Therefore, these names can do what Krsna can do. They can give liberation and they can take us to Goloka Vrndavana. In Vrndavana, Krsna will engage us in the service of Srimati Radhika and Himself, and thus we will be happy forever. Everyone who meets me and begins chanting the names of Krsna says the same thing: "By chanting I am happier than ever before." We find this in all countries, including America, South America, Malaysia, Australia, Russia, and China. In fact, we find that in Russia and China people are more receptive than in most other countries. So many people have come to me. I have made many of them full-time celibate monks, and now they are also traveling around the world and spreading this message."
